A macular hole does not cause complete blindness and does not affect the peripheral (side) vision. ![]() The hole also typically enlarges to a point at which the affected eye can only see the larger letters of an eye chart. As the hole enlarges, the vision becomes progressively worse. In the early stages of macular hole formation, the hole is very small and the central vision may be only slightly blurred or distorted. We also see a macular hole in a very small percentage of people with retinal detachment, or in conditions that cause severe edema (swelling) of the retina. Occasionally, severe blunt trauma can cause a macular hole. This type of macular hole that most commonly occurs in individuals over the age of 50, we refer to as an idiopathic macular hole. In most cases, a macular hole develops as a result of anatomical changes that occur spontaneously and not from anything that the patient has done.
